Drug addiction is a formidable challenge that can ravage lives. Positively, there are comprehensive treatment programs designed to assist individuals on their path to recovery. These programs offer a holistic strategy that addresses the physical, emotional, and social aspects of addiction.
Through these programs, patients are provided with a variety of proven therapies. These types of therapies include cognitive behavioral therapy, group therapy, medication-assisted treatment, and individual counseling.
Moreover, comprehensive drug addiction treatment programs often embed health modifications into their program. This can entail healthy eating habits, regular exercise, stress management techniques, and guidance in developing coping mechanisms.

Dual Diagnosis Treatment: Addressing Both Mental Health and Substance Use Disorders
Individuals with co-occurring disorders face unique challenges as they grapple with both mental health and substance use disorders. Effective treatment demands a comprehensive approach that targets the underlying causes of both conditions. Treatment programs often involve a combination of therapy, medication, mutual aid, and lifestyle changes. By adapting treatment to each individual's specific needs, providers can assist individuals achieve lasting recovery and improve their overall well-being.
- Therapy can provide a safe and supportive space for individuals to examine their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ors related to both mental health and substance use.
- Medication can be used to manage symptoms of both conditions, reducing the severity and frequency of episodes.
- Support groups offer a sense of community and connection, providing individuals with inspiration and practical tips for relapse prevention.
Inpatient Rehab Services: A Sanctuary for Recovery
For individuals embarking on the journey of recovery from illness or injury, inpatient rehabilitation services offer a haven of specialized care and compassionate support. Within these dedicated facilities, patients are enveloped in an environment designed to foster healing, strengthen their physical abilities, and empower them to regain independence.
The comprehensive nature of inpatient rehab encompasses a multidisciplinary approach, drawing upon the expertise of doctors, nurses, occupational therapists, speech therapists, and physical therapists, each contributing to the patient's holistic well-being.
- Structured treatment plans are tailored to individual needs, addressing specific goals and challenges.
- Patients engage in a variety of therapies, extending from strength training and balance exercises to cognitive rehabilitation and adaptive techniques.
- Furthermore, inpatient rehab facilities often providecomforting group sessions and recreational activities, fostering a sense of community and emotional well-being.
Inpatient rehabilitation serves as a sanctuary for recovery, providing not only the medical expertise but also the nurturing environment essential for patients to prosper on their path to wellness.
Route to Healing: Effective Inpatient and Outpatient Rehab Options
Recovering from substance abuse can be a tough process. Thankfully, there are various rehab options available to help individuals navigate this journey. Inpatient and outpatient centers offer unique approaches that cater to varying needs and circumstances.
Inpatient rehab, a more dedicated approach, involves residing at a dedicated facility for an extended time. This allows for 24/7 care in a structured atmosphere, providing individuals with the chance to fully focus on their recovery.
Outpatient rehab, on the other hand, allows individuals to continue their daily lives while receiving treatment. This can be a suitable choice for those who require more versatility in their schedule.
Ultimately, the most effective route to healing depends on individual factors.
Whether choosing inpatient or outpatient rehab, it's crucial to explore different options and find a program that aligns with your goals.
